As students return to school, young people may encounter challenges in navigating their academic environment. Those grappling with mental wellbeing issues may find it hard to maintain focus, lack motivation, and suffer from low self-esteem. These challenges can significantly affect their academic performance and overall quality of life.

Discovery journals aim to address this. Each journal is thoughtfully crafted based on the lived experience of individuals with anxiety disorders, with a primary focus on guiding users through their daily experiences in a structured manner. By doing so, these journals assist users in constructing a coherent narrative of recurring events and emotions, facilitating a deeper understanding of their anxiety.

For teens, the goal is to encourage communication and promote honesty; focus on peer interaction and relationships; challenge the effects of social media usage, and much more.

The private journal gets you thinking about your day more than you usually would and gets you to describe your day in an engaging way. You can compare your entries over weeks and self-reflect by finding potential anxiety triggers and track when and where they occur.
